Luis P. has over twenty years of experience in software development. Luis began their career in 1999 as a Senior Web Applications Engineer at HSBC Argentina. In 2002, they moved to COTO as a Senior Software Engineer. In 2003, they became a Development Manager at Infinite Software Corporation, where they worked on Infinite Cloud, Infinite Web and Infinite iSeries products. In 2009, they founded Routeck, where they were the Chief Technology Officer and worked on mission-critical software development projects for the retail, commercial and manufacturing industries. In 2012, they became the Chief Technology Officer at Axigma Technologies. Most recently, Luis has been the Director of Engineering and Co-Founder at AccelOne since 2014, providing software development services to companies located worldwide.
